REDbox: a comprehensive semantic framework for data collection and management in tuberculosis research
Abstract The outcomes of a clinical research directly depend on the correct definition of the research protocol, the data collection strategy and the data management plan. Furthermore, researchers often need to work within challenging contexts, such as in Tuberculosis services, where human and technological resources for research may be rare. The use of Electronic Data Capture systems, such as REDCap and KoBotoolbox, can help to mitigate such risks and to enable a reliable environment to conduct health research and promote results dissemination and data reusability. The proposed solution was based on needs pinpointed by researchers, considering the lack of an embracing solution to conduct research in low resources environments. The REDbox framework was built to enhance data collection, management and sharing in tuberculosis research, while providing a better user experience. The relevance of this article lies in the innovative approach to support TB research by combining existing technologies and developing support features. When focusing on positive aspects of each tool, it is possible to underpin tuberculosis research by improving data collection, management capability and security. Furthermore, the aggregation of meaning in raw data helps to promote the quality and the availability of research data.
